Liner Notes
#dance #JazzButNotReally #steampunk #CheatersDozen
I started the first minute of this last year, and decided to keep going tonight. It sounds jazzy to me, but my wife (who helped me name this track) called it steampunk, so who knows?
I wanted that piano part to sound like a warped sample from an old jazz record or something, and then I decided maybe the whole thing is from a record that got warped, and the parts aren't playing nicely together how they're supposed to.
